摘要
PV module or a cluster of module failure leads to lower the generating time rate and decrease its power amount. Detection and repair are apprehended to be the constructor's burden. This study aims to constitute the diagnosis function and system. In the future, this mechanism assumes to detect some faults and failures automatically. This method enables to acquire I-V curves of PV modules strings; each I-V curve is divided into two areas. One area is Voltage dependent areas, which voltage varies less, to combine the input capacitance inside of a power conditioner and the variable DC power. This configuration enables to reduce DC power capacity. The other area is Current dependent. I-V characteristic is obtained in each two areas and connected. Consequently, I-V curve of all part is acquired without preventing PV generation from suspension a little. The measurement function and method were investigated and performed. The availability is confirmed to acquire I-V curve for diagnosis detection.
